The Dripfeed service logs at ~40k lines/sec, so Korvax samples at 1:200 in normal operation. During break-glass access, sampling drops to 1:10 automatically for the affected tenant. Break-glass sessions require two approvers on the Halloway team and expire after four hours. To open a session when the approval bot is down, supply the standing recovery passphrase below.

unlock words, yawig-kagef: gordor-holvan-ulaael-pramir-ulaiel-tamdor

Title: Scheduler double-waters bed 3 after DST shift

New folks: the Verdella scheduler stores watering slots in local time. After the clock change, slot 06:00 fires twice, soaking the herb bed. Fix: store UTC, convert at display. Repro on the Oakhollow test rig only. To reproduce, install the firmware identified by the token below.

build token for hafop-kahog: htk31_a432ac515d5bb1362002c1e1a7e80ef

# Compaction notes for the Brindlewave queue cluster — prepared for the weekly eng sync.
# Log compaction on the orders topic now runs hourly instead of daily; this cut disk usage
# on the Kettleford brokers by roughly forty percent. Retention tuning is owned by Priya's
# team, so coordinate before changing segment sizes. Compaction metrics ship to the Lanternview
# dashboard. The compactor authenticates to the broker admin API, and its credential must be
# the very next line in this file.

sealed setting: VAULT_KEY20=dd440a383707adecf165

Runbook fragment — Recalled charger returns, Ashgrove receiving site

The pallet of recalled Voltaren-series chargers from the Kettleworth depot is shrink-wrapped, banded, and tagged with orange recall labels on all four sides. On arrival, verify the seal numbers against the manifest before breaking the wrap, and quarantine the pallet in Bay 3 away from sellable stock. Do not release any units for reuse under any circumstances. The courier delivering the pallet must first be given the confidential hand-over instruction that follows below.

drop instructions, yafog-yawip: the quenmir olidor courier leaves the julox tamion keliel ledger at gate 5283 under passcode 336825